Corona Virus on 17:59 - Mar 21 by Jack_Kass | London is taking a kicking, and is our Milan. They need to put a cordon/lockdown on it, immediately. |
Partly there are always going to be lots of cases in big, crowded cities. But also, London hospitals are taking people from elsewhere due to specialist facilities, And they are then recorded as London cases, or London deaths. The cases would have been elsewhere anyway. As an example, the first Swansea case was transferred to London. If that happened now, it would show in London numbers as testing is now hospital based. |  | |  |

Corona Virus on 17:38 - Mar 21 by waynekerr55 | Probably due to the grading - has anyone out there said about the standard needed to stop the virus getting through a mask? |
No, it's that the mask has to fit the wearer, to ensure a tight seal. Thats why you need to be face-fit tested to confirm the mask is providing the correct protection. Also need to be clean shaven if wearing disposable masks. |  | |  |
